Subject: [PATCH v2 3/3] multifd: Send using asynchronous write on nocomp to send RAM pages.
Date: Wed, 22 Sep 2021 02:03:40 -0300

Change multifd nocomp version to use asynchronous write for RAM pages, and
benefit of MSG_ZEROCOPY when it's available.

The asynchronous flush happens on cleanup only, before destroying the 
QIOChannel.

This will work fine on RAM migration because the RAM pages are not usually 
freed,
and there is no problem on changing the pages content between async_send() and
the actual sending of the buffer, because this change will dirty the page and
cause it to be re-sent on a next iteration anyway.
